
The persistent North Korea nuclear weapons crisis is generating heightened fear among the countries targeted by Pyongyang for hostile signaling, including the United States. Washington reacted strongly to the DPRK’s fourth nuclear test in January, leading the effort in the United Nations Security Council to impose a new set of sanctions that observers say is tougher than usual. Nevertheless, it is uncertain whether China will fully enforce these sanctions, and indeed whether any sanctions short of a total international economic embargo (to which China is not agreeable) would force Pyongyang to abandon its nuclear weapons and intercontinental ballistic missile (ICBM) programs.
